The Dallas Symphony Orchestra is seeking a Part-Time Contract Site Leader for the Kim Noltemy Young Musicians program, dedicated to transforming lives and communities through intensive orchestral music education. Designed to nurture and empower youth across Dallas, Young Musicians provides students in grades 1–12 and their families with free music instruction, instruments, performance opportunities, and mentorship.

Inspired by El Sistema, Venezuela’s model of music education, Young Musicians provides intensive orchestral and group instruction focused on transforming students’ lives and communities through musical and social excellence. The Site Leader serves as both the artistic and operational lead for an assigned campus, providing high-quality music instruction, leading site-wide orchestra rehearsals, coordinating daily program activities, and supporting Teaching Artists in alignment with the Young Musicians/El Sistema educational philosophy.

The Site Leader is expected to be an expert on their instrument, prepared to lead full sectionals and orchestra rehearsals across instrument families as needed, and committed to fostering a collaborative, student-centered learning environment. This role works closely with Teaching Artists, students, families, school partners, and Dallas Symphony Orchestra staff to ensure program success through strong communication, effective coordination, and a shared commitment to musical and social excellence.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ead site-wide orchestra rehearsals and support students across instrument families in alignment with the Young Musicians/El Sistema educational philosophy.
  • Develop and manage class schedules, coordinate daily site operations, and delegate responsibilities to Teaching Artists to support effective instruction.
  • Facilitate weekly team meetings with Teaching Artists to communicate artistic goals, operational updates, schedules, and program expectations.
  • Attend bi-weekly Site Leader meetings at the Meyerson with fellow Site Leaders and Dallas Symphony Orchestra staff to collaborate on program planning and initiatives.
  • Serve as the primary communication liaison for the assigned campus by sharing important updates with families, Teaching Artists, school partners, and DSO staff.
  • Maintain consistent communication with Teaching Artists and DSO staff through Slack and other communication platforms.
  • Coordinate instrument maintenance by transporting instruments requiring repair to and from the Meyerson Symphony Center.
  • Submit requests for program supplies and materials, including instrument accessories, classroom supplies, and other instructional needs.
  • Support Teaching Artists by fostering a collaborative environment that encourages communication, feedback, and continuous improvement.
  • Maintain a positive, organized, and inclusive learning environment that promotes student growth, creativity, teamwork, and musical excellence.
  • Support student performances, special events, and other program initiatives as assigned.
